In cases where the new will does not entirely deal with the estate, meaning that the will certainly neglects specific parts of the estate, after that the will is thought to be contributing to the terms of the previous will. Whenever a brand-new will certainly omits part of an estate, after that one of the most current will that reviews that part of the estate is assumed to be legitimate, partially, except in situations where the new will definitively proclaims all previous wills void.

Is holographic will valid in the Philippines?

In the Philippines, notarial and holographic wills are subject to different requirements for credibility. A notarial will has to be checked in the visibility of 2 witnesses and a notary public, while a holographic will must be completely in the handwriting of the testator.
